The Human Race is a statewide community fundraising event that encourages
participants to raise money for their favorite nonprofit organization. The race is
organized by local Volunteer Centers.

EVERYBODY can join the PSA team, collect pledges, and walk, ride the wheelchair or run with us. The Human Race is
the annual premier community fundraising event providing all nonprofit organizations the opportunity to raise money
for their programs and services. The event is produced by the Volunteer Center of Silicon Valley.
Activities include a USA Track and Field certified 10K run, 5K run and a 5K Pledge Walk. The course is flat and
wheelchair accessible. Roller blades, scooters and strollers are welcome on the walk course. Pledge walkers with
leashed dogs have a separate course.
